the first step is to select the appropriate content-free cloud server and regional nodes: give priority to suppliers with pops in seoul/busan, and pay attention to bandwidth peak capabilities, network egress strategies, and slas. traffic billing, elastic public ip and ddos protection should be clarified in the business evaluation.
the second step is to build an efficient encoding and transcoding link: it is recommended to use the containerized ffmpeg pipeline or cloud gpu transcoding instance to support multi-bitrate output (hls/dash). store original source and intermediate files in object storage, and set lifecycle policies to save costs.
in the third step, the distribution layer adopts a hybrid model: combining self-built cdn edge caching and third-party cdn acceleration, and setting up geo routing, cache control and back-to-origin strategies to ensure that domestic and foreign audiences have a low-latency experience.
security and compliance are crucial: ssl /tls full-link encryption must be enabled, drm solutions must be connected (widevine/playready/fairplay depends on the target device), copyright verification and rapid offline processes must be established, and south korea's personal information protection act (pipa) and related content supervision requirements must be complied with.
operation and maintenance automation and elastic scaling: use kubernetes or container orchestration to realize automatic scaling of services, combined with load balancers and health checks. the log, indicator and alarm system should cover key indicators such as bandwidth, concurrent sessions, transcoding delay and error rate.
performance optimization tips: multiplexing, http/2, and quic can reduce connection overhead; use sharding and prefetching strategies to reduce lags; configure static preheating for popular content and monitor back-to-origin pressure.
business and operational suggestions: clarify content compliance and payment strategies, connect to payment and billing systems; design bandwidth and storage cost models, set cache hit rate and oss hot and cold tiering to control expenditures.
testing and launch list: complete end-to-end stress test, network jitter test, drm authorization transfer test, sudden traffic increase and failover drill. develop rollback strategies and sla commitments to ensure predictable user experience.
